黑狐家游戏

前端和后端数据不一致需要刷新什么,前端与后端数据不一致,如何巧妙刷新以提升用户体验?

欧气 0 0

本文目录导读:

  1. 前端与后端数据不一致的原因
  2. 巧妙刷新的方法

在当今互联网时代,前端和后端数据不一致的现象时有发生,给用户带来了诸多困扰,数据不一致可能导致用户看到的页面信息与实际数据不符,甚至影响到用户体验,面对这种情况,我们该如何巧妙地进行刷新,以提升用户体验呢?

前端与后端数据不一致的原因

1、数据更新不及时:前端展示的数据可能来源于后端数据库,如果后端数据更新后前端未能及时获取到,就会出现数据不一致的情况。

2、缓存问题:浏览器缓存或服务器缓存可能导致用户获取到的数据不是最新的。

3、数据同步机制不完善:前端与后端的数据同步机制不完善,可能导致数据更新时出现偏差。

前端和后端数据不一致需要刷新什么,前端与后端数据不一致,如何巧妙刷新以提升用户体验?

图片来源于网络,如有侵权联系删除

4、数据传输错误:数据在传输过程中可能受到干扰,导致数据错误。

巧妙刷新的方法

1、智能刷新:通过监听数据变化,实现智能刷新,当后端数据更新时,前端自动获取最新数据,更新页面内容。

具体实现方法如下:

(1)前端页面加载完成后,使用WebSocket或轮询技术实时监听后端数据变化。

(2)后端数据更新时,主动推送更新信息至前端。

(3)前端接收到更新信息后,根据业务需求进行页面刷新或局部刷新。

2、手动刷新:当用户发现数据不一致时,可手动点击刷新按钮,更新页面数据。

具体实现方法如下:

(1)在页面底部或侧边栏添加刷新按钮。

前端和后端数据不一致需要刷新什么,前端与后端数据不一致,如何巧妙刷新以提升用户体验?

图片来源于网络,如有侵权联系删除

(2)用户点击刷新按钮后,前端通过Ajax请求获取最新数据,更新页面内容。

3、定时刷新:设置定时刷新机制,每隔一段时间自动刷新页面数据。

具体实现方法如下:

(1)在页面底部或侧边栏添加定时刷新选项。

(2)用户选择定时刷新时间后,前端根据设置的时间间隔自动刷新页面数据。

4、无刷新页面:通过无刷新技术(如Ajax、Fetch等)实现页面局部刷新,提高用户体验。

具体实现方法如下:

(1)前端页面加载完成后,使用Ajax或Fetch等技术异步获取数据。

(2)根据业务需求,更新页面局部内容。

前端和后端数据不一致需要刷新什么,前端与后端数据不一致,如何巧妙刷新以提升用户体验?

图片来源于网络,如有侵权联系删除

5、数据版本控制:在数据更新时,为数据添加版本号,前端通过比较版本号判断数据是否需要更新。

具体实现方法如下:

(1)后端在数据更新时,为数据添加版本号。

(2)前端在获取数据时,比较本地数据版本号与服务器数据版本号。

(3)若版本号不一致,则更新数据。

前端与后端数据不一致是常见问题,但通过巧妙地刷新方法,可以有效提升用户体验,在实际开发过程中,应根据业务需求选择合适的刷新策略,以提高应用性能和用户体验,加强前端与后端的沟通与协作,优化数据同步机制,从源头上减少数据不一致现象的发生。

标签: #前端和后端数据不一致需要刷新

黑狐家游戏
  • 评论列表

留言评论